When it comes to cutting costs, government programs often offer free or discounted services to people. How to make money stretch further than you ever thought is sometimes just a phone call away. Ask your local utility provider if there are any government assistance programs to help pay your bills, they will almost always tell that there are and you can get the information from them directly to see if you qualify for any of them.
Even a ten percent discount on your bill is better than nothing, and it is free money that you didn't have in your pocket before. There are also tuition assistance of waivers for those not making big money for local colleges, grants for business start ups, and even housing assistance for those who qualify. If you are not rich, you may qualify for a lot more than you think, even if you are working and receiving a decent paycheck.
Many times you will find that there are a lot of ways you can find how to make money with government assistance programs. Many of these programs are not put out to the public, and can be hard to discover, but once you have tapped into them you will enjoy a great resource that can really help you keep your life budgeted right.
Discovering how to make money with government programs is an ongoing process. There are different programs available each fiscal year, and some guidelines change as well, so you have to stay educated on what it takes to qualify for each program or grant.
